The spring 2008 collection of Ibanez guitars breaks the rules of a usual style and gives in a unique ethnic flavor.
Most of renowned guitars as Epiphone guitars, Gibson, Fender and others have some traditions and even new instruments commonly get the appearance that looks like all their classic series, but Ibanez rejected to do the same. Surely, that is the sound which prior of all matters in a guitar instrument, but when the instrument is also a pleasure for the eyes, satisfaction doubles.
When you look at the guitars which were introduced as Spring 2008 Special Limited Edition you understand that Ibanez is a Japanese brand. Some new models as RG and SRX include wonderful trademark's sound standards and sophisticated appearance. With their “Japan black” finish and red binding, special sakura blossom carving and gold hardware, they are extremely stylish and really Japanese. That is a great proposal in Ibanez spring collection for guitar players of all ages which is called Talman Acoustics. They are simple and advanced guitars simultaneously. Amazing skull theme makes Talman Acoustic series to be an instrument for genuine fans of rock. There is also hard-rock-style Ibanez logo. Another pattern, a sun around the rosette with its rays expanding over the yellow wood top, gives you back again to the springs of the trademark and reminds you of the Land of the Rising Sun.
The spring 2008 collection presented the new PM-35 from Pat Metheny, who's been with Ibanez for about 20 years. That is great that everybody can afford to buy such guitars. The prices for the production of that class are considered to be intermediate, so it can be utilized by young guitar players who just start improving their techniques. “I am really glad to have this instrument out there and available for anyone,” noticed the world-known jazz composer.
